Rupiah Strengthens 132 Points on Tuesday Evening

Jakarta, 26 Dzulhijjah 1437/28 September 2016 (MINA) – The Indonesian rupiah closed stronger against the dollar at 12,909 on Tuesday evening on the rising amount of redemption from the tax amnesty program, Antara reported, quoting a money market observer.

The rupiah rose 132 points compared to the previous close of 13,041 per dollar.

Money market observer Rully Nova of Bank Woori Saudara Indonesia Tbk said the rising redemption fund from the tax amnesty program was one of positive sentiments for the local unit to continue its rally against the dollar.

“The sentiment towards the tax amnesty program has helped strengthen the rupiah while money market players are anticipating political condition in the US ahead of presidential election there,” he said.

Data from the Directorate General of Taxation show that the total amount of assets declared as of September 27 reached Rp2,141 trillion comprising Rp1,653 trillion worth of declared domestic assets, Rp637 trillion worth of declared foreign assets and Rp125 trillion worth of repatriation fund.

After all, he said the rupiahs appreciation was relatively limited, with Bank Indonesia expected to prevent it from disrupting the countrys export.

“The rupiah will be safeguarded according to its fundamentals,” he said.

On the external side, the US presidential debate had caused market players to exercise caution in accumulating US dollar-denominated assets, he said.

“The accumulation of sentiments towards the Federal Reserve maintaining its benchmark rate and the political condition ahead of presidential election has caused the dollar to weaken,” he said. (T/R07/R01)
